Creating an effective content calendar requires that marketers be thoughtful, flexible, and creative. Panelists will explore approaching calendars from a strategic perspective down to the nuts and bolts of execution and logistics. Attendees will also leave with tips on incorporating content calendar planning into their social media workload.
